Manohar Parrikar Health Update: Goa Chief Minister to Return to India on June 15, Claims BJP MLA
Manohar Parrikar had to be hospitalised in Mumbaiās Lilavati Hospital thrice earlier this year and was also admitted in the Goa Medical College during mid-February.
Mumbai, June 13: Goa Chief Minister Manohar Parrikar, who is recovering from a cancerous disease, is likely to return to India this week. The mystery around the ailing chief minister just saw another twist in the tale, as BJP leaders were seenĀ giving contradictory statements to the media in Panaji. As per a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) MLA, Parrikar will mark his return to the state on June 15.
Talking to media in Panaji about Manohar Parrikarās return to India, BJP MLA Nilesh Cabral said, āParrikar is returning to Goa on June 15.ā On the contrary, a senior BJP functionary informed that Parrikar was likely to return to Goa somewhere by the end of this month; however, his exact date wasnāt confirmed yet.
The BJP official said that the exact date of Parrikarās arrival isnāt known yet and his return tickets havenāt been booked yet. āAs a party, we do not know his exact date of arrival. The former Defence Minister was admitted in a US hospital in the month of March this year. The 62-year-old senior BJP leader had to be hospitalised in Mumbaiās Lilavati Hospital thrice earlier this year and was also admitted in the Goa Medical College during mid-February.
